2-[[6-(aminomethyl)imidazo[1,2-a]pyridin-2-yl]methyl]-2,7-naphthyridin-1-one;ethane (PubChem CID 168971053) has the molecular formula C19H21N5O
and a molecular weight of 335.41 g/mol. Its IUPAC name is 2-[[6-(aminomethyl)imidazo[1,2-a]pyridin-2-yl]methyl]-2,7-naphthyridin-1-one;ethane.

What is the SMILES notation for 2-[[6-(aminomethyl)imidazo[1,2-a]pyridin-2-yl]methyl]-2,7-naphthyridin-1-one;ethane?
The canonical SMILES for 2-[[6-(aminomethyl)imidazo[1,2-a]pyridin-2-yl]methyl]-2,7-naphthyridin-1-one;ethane is CC.NCc1ccc2nc(Cn3ccc4ccncc4c3=O)cn2c1.
What is the InChIKey of 2-[[6-(aminomethyl)imidazo[1,2-a]pyridin-2-yl]methyl]-2,7-naphthyridin-1-one;ethane?
The InChIKey is RERSOAXUFAZPAE-UHFFFAOYSA-N. The full InChI is InChI=1S/C17H15N5O.C2H6/c18-7-12-1-2-16-20-14(11-22(16)9-12)10-21-6-4-13-3-5-19-8-15(13)17(21)23;1-2/h1-6,8-9,11H,7,10,18H2;1-2H3.
What are the key properties of 2-[[6-(aminomethyl)imidazo[1,2-a]pyridin-2-yl]methyl]-2,7-naphthyridin-1-one;ethane?
2-[[6-(aminomethyl)imidazo[1,2-a]pyridin-2-yl]methyl]-2,7-naphthyridin-1-one;ethane has a molecular weight of 335.41 g/mol, XLogP of 2.58, 3 rotatable bonds, 1 hydrogen bond donors, and 6 hydrogen bond acceptors.
